Kandyan Convention Signed by British and Kandyans
The Kandyan Convention was signed between British colonial forces and leaders of the Kingdom of Kandy in Ceylon. This agreement marked the end of hostilities and established British control over the region, leading to the formal annexation of the Kandyan territories. The signatories included Major Thomas Marshall representing the British and various leaders from the Kingdom of Kandy. The treaty facilitated the transition of political power and aimed to ensure peace in the region, albeit under foreign domination.

What Happened?
The signing of the Kandyan Convention represented a significant turning point in the history of Sri Lanka, specifically for the Kingdom of Kandy. After years of resistance against British colonial expansion, the Kandyans agreed to the treaty as their forces faced military setbacks. The British, having taken control of the coastal areas of Ceylon, sought to pacify the mountainous interior where the Kingdom of Kandy was located. On February 2, 1815, at the Nuwara Eliya Convention, British representatives led by Major Thomas Marshall engaged in talks with local Kandyan leaders. The conditions of the agreement included promises of protection and the maintenance of the Kandyan monarchy under British sovereignty, a delicate compromise intended to foster coexistence.After the signing, the British consolidated their power, which ultimately led to the full annexation of the Kingdom of Kandy in 1824. The Kandyan Convention was characterized by both negotiations and the troubling context of military force, as resistance continued even after the treaty. Additionally, it represented the complexities of colonial diplomacy where terms were often dictated by the more dominant powers. While the Kandyans initially sought to preserve their autonomy and culture, this agreement marked a significant loss of independence for the Kandyan Kingdom and its people.
Why Does it Matter?
The Kandyan Convention is interesting as it symbolizes the systemic shift from local governance to colonial administration. The treaty facilitated the complete British control over Sri Lanka, marking the end of significant resistance from the Kingdom of Kandy and the establishment of colonial order in the central highlands. It altered the socio-political landscape of Sri Lanka, incorporating the Kandyan territories into British rule and setting a precedent for future interactions between colonial powers and local rulers.
